The Eleventh Commandment


Is this too much to ask for? Is it too complicated to have people be honest with you? Is telling you when you've done something well just as hard as telling you when you've messed up? Apparently so.

Honesty is pretty much not valued here and bosses and employees alike can't seem to get in touch with their inner righteous selves. Everyone says that they wish they could truly be honest and have people be honest with them, but to what extent is this a mere ploy to make people believe that there is actually some sense of democracy within the scheme of things?

If you needed it cleared up, trust in that there isn't an appreciation for the observations of the middle low class of an ad agency. It's good that you have an opinion, but as with weddings when they ask if anyone should have an objection, just bite your tongue. Higher-ups will project themselves to be understanding and up for listening to every one who has something that he or she has to share..... bullshit, and please don't insist on proving me wrong, because in 4 out of 5 agencies, this is the truth. Tried and true methods of controlling the worker bees shall not change and faking empathy is a definite classic scenario, especially in advertising.

I'll stop if you've never heard one of these phrases:

"My office is always open for anyone."
"You can always call my office."
"I care about what each and everyone of you has to say."
"We have to pull together to overcome these bad times."

Can't you see the high school coach in most every associated vice president in a company? Are you truly fooled by the false sense of security they so halfassedly bestow upon each department? Something tells me that you don't buy the bullshit. So why do people insist on using these "tactics" to control its working force? Well like some of the worlds most famous predators, sometimes evolution is not necessary, just look for a more convenient habitat to adapt more easily to. In advertising that translates into exploiting your workforce until they learn to be wiser... then fire them because knowledge, rebellion and a sense of self respect are all contagious ... and heaven knows those three aspects could spell doom for a company that insists on not following the 11th commandment.
